Meet Keisha Mira Velarde, an ordinary, humble woman who wants nothing more than a peaceful life. She is someone who does not look for drama or attention. However, beneath her quiet exterior, she carries deep emotional trauma that has left a lasting mark on her mind and heart.
To protect herself from further pain, Keisha builds heavy emotional walls, choosing isolation over the vulnerability of connection. These barriers make trusting others feel nearly impossible, creating a constant internal battle as she struggles to let people in and learn how to love again. But she isn't entirely alone; hope arrives in the form of true friends who refuse to let her slip away, lifting her up whenever she falls into darkness.
Could Iñigo be the one to finally break down the heavy walls around her heart, proving that it is safe to trust, to heal, and to love again? By showing her a patient, gentle kind of devotion, will he ultimately guide her to give herself permission to finally be happy? And when the ghosts of her past demand a reckoning, will she discover that the ultimate act of survival is finding the strength to forgive-not to excuse the pain, and not for the sake of those who hurt her, but as the only true way to set herself free?
